Looking expensive on a budget is all about creating an impression of elegance, sophistication, and attention to detail. While you may not have a large amount of money to spend, there are several tips and tricks you can follow to achieve a luxurious look without breaking the bank. Here are some suggestions:

                                                  

  1. Emphasize fit and tailoring: Well-fitted clothing instantly elevates your appearance. Seek out affordable options that fit you perfectly and consider getting them tailored if necessary. A tailored outfit, even if it's from an affordable store, will make you look more polished and put together.

  2. Opt for classic and timeless pieces: Trends come and go, but classic pieces never go out of style. Invest in quality wardrobe staples like a well-tailored blazer, a little black dress, a crisp white shirt, or a pair of well-fitting jeans. These items can be mixed and matched to create a variety of looks and will always exude sophistication.

  3. Pay attention to fabric choice: Fabrics that have a luxurious look and feel can instantly elevate your outfit. Look for natural fibers like cotton, silk, wool, or linen, as they tend to give a more upscale appearance compared to synthetic materials. Even if the price tag is low, the right fabric choice can make your outfit look more expensive.

  4. Focus on accessories: Accessories can make or break an outfit. Invest in a few key pieces like a statement necklace, a classic watch, a quality handbag, or a well-crafted belt. These accessories can elevate even the simplest of outfits and give them a more expensive feel.

  5. Keep it simple and minimal: Avoid excessive patterns, logos, or flashy details that can cheapen the overall look. Opt for clean lines, simple designs, and a cohesive color palette. A minimalist approach to your outfit and accessories can create a sophisticated and high-end impression.

  6. Pay attention to grooming: Your personal grooming habits can significantly impact how you are perceived. Take care of your hair, nails, and skin. Ensure your clothes are clean, wrinkle-free, and well-maintained. Good grooming habits can make even inexpensive clothing look more expensive.

  7. Confidence is key: No matter what you wear, confidence is the ultimate accessory. Stand tall, maintain good posture, and wear your clothes with confidence. A self-assured demeanor will make you look more put together and stylish.

Remember, looking expensive doesn't necessarily mean spending a lot of money. It's all about paying attention to the details, making thoughtful choices, and presenting yourself with confidence and style.
